iRobot Roomba 760
Roombas make use of a combination of sensors to navigate the floor. They’re programmed to stay clear of objects and power cords, and many come with cliff sensors that stop them from falling down stairs. Sensors prevent them from becoming stuck in pet hair or carpet fibers.
Roomba uses soundwaves to detect dirt on carpeting and flooring. It then scrubbing that area several times before moving onto the next one. This method of cleaning gives a deep clean smart robot and reduces allergens in the air.
The Roomba 760 comes with a dustbin that can hold up to 60 days of trash. The Roomba 760 is able to be emptied by pressing the button. The Roomba comes with an remote that permits it to be operated from the distance. It is quite quiet, with a noise at a level of just 60 dB. iRobot Roomba 570
Roombas are powered by rechargeable nickel-metal-hydride batteries that need to be recharged frequently using a power adapter. Most modern models have docking stations and a home base, where they automatically dock. The home base also acts as a virtual barrier to keep the robot from certain areas.
Earlier models must be told the area’s size and later models calculate it by using the longest straight line they can travel without hitting an obstacle. They may also use dirt detection to determine how dirty an area is.
Certain models come with an accessory called Scheduler that enables the owner to program the robot vacuum cleaner sale to begin cleaning at certain times. A dongle known as OSMO connects to the robot’s serial port to upgrade it to version 2.1 software. This fixes a bug that could cause a Roomba perform an “circle-dance” during cleaning.
